Background
Griffin, Marvin Anthony was born on March 28, 1923 in Pine Apple, Alabama, United States. Son of Randolph Simpson and Linnie (Barrett) Griffin.

Bachelor of Science, Auburn University, 1949. Master of Science Engineering, University Alabama, 1952. Doctor of Engineering, Johns Hopkins, 1960.
Chief operations analysis, Anniston Ordnance Depot, Alabama, 1949-1951;
senior manufacturing engineer, Western Electric Company, Winston-Salem, North Carolina, 1952-1955;
chief engineering, Cumberland Manufacturing Company, Chattanooga, 1955-1957;
instructor, Johns Hopkins, 1957-1960;
chief industrial engineer, Matson Navigation Company, San Francisco, 1960-1961;
vice president corporate development, Matson Navigation Company, 1977-1978;
group vice president, Matson Navigation Company, 1978-1979;
professor industrial engineering, U. Alabama, 1961-1976;
department chairman, U. Alabama, 1965-1971;
department chairman computer science and operations research, U. Alabama, 1971-1976;
director computer science, U. Alabama, 1969-1976;
professor industrial engineering and computer science, U. Alabama, since 1980;
professor emeritus industrial engineering, U. Alabama, since 1987;
department chairman, U. Alabama, since 1983. Member maritime transportation research board, maritime information committee National Academy Science, since 1976. Management consultant to industry, government.
Labor arbitrator Federal Mediation and Conciliation Service, American Arbitration Association. Consultant industrial engineering, operations research, arbitration, mediation services, 1987-1992.
Served to commander of The United States Navy Reserve, 1943-1947, PTO. Member Operations Research Society American, American Institute Industrial Engineers (director 1954-1955, chapter president 1959-1960), American Society Engineering Education, Institute Management Science, Association Computing Machinery, Johns Hopkins Society Scholars.
Married Jane Pearle A. L'Herisson, September 4, 1949 (deceased December 1992). Children: Margaret Lynn, John Marvin, Barbara Lee, Elizabeth Annual.
